老年2型糖尿病、糖耐量异常、空腹血糖受损患者血小板膜糖蛋白PAC-1和CD62P的研究

摘    要:目的检测2型糖尿病(T2DM)、糖耐量异常(IGT)、空腹血糖受损(IFG)患者血小板膜糖蛋白PAC-1和CD62P表达水平,研究不同血糖状态下血小板活化的程度.方法分别选取老年T2DM、IGT、IFG患者和健康对照组(NC)各30例,采集静脉血测定空腹血糖(FPG)、餐后2小时血糖(2hPBG)、甘油三酯(TG)、总胆固醇(TC)、高密度脂蛋白胆固醇(HDL-C)、低密度脂蛋白胆固醇(LDL-C)、糖化血红蛋白(HbA1c)等,同时运用流式细胞分析术(FCM)测定血小板膜糖蛋白PAC-1和CD62P的表达水平.结果 T2DM组、IGT组、IFG组的PAC-1和CD62P较NC组明显升高(P〈0.05),而T2DM组的表达最高.多因素线性相关分析,血小板膜糖蛋白PAC-1和CD62P与FPG、2hPBG、TG、TC、HbA1c、LDL-C呈正相关,与HDL-C负相关,且与TG和FPG相关性较高.结论血小板活化在糖尿病前期就已经存在,在糖代谢紊乱患者早期血栓病变的发生发展中发挥着关键的作用.

Research of Platelet Membrane Glycoprotein PAC-1 and CD62P in Elderly Patients with Type 2 Diabetes,Impaired Glucose Tolerance and Impaired Fasting Glucose

Abstract:Objective To test the levels of platelet membrane glycoprotein PAC-1 and CD62P in elderly patients with type 2 diabetes mellitus(T2DM),impaired glucose tolerance(IGT)and impaired fasting glucose(IFG),and to investigate platelet activation under conditions of different blood glucose levels.Methods Thirty elderly patients with respective T2DM,IGT or IFG as well as normal controls(NC)were enrolled.The venous blood of patients in each group were collected for the examinations of the fasting plasma glucose(FPG),...
